Moving from the SW Vegas area to NW Vegas(Providence) I needed to find a good place for my hair cuts. I’m real particular about this as are some other guys. My only reservation about barber shops is that they tend to cut hair and make it always look like you went in for a military style cut. Also, my other reservation about beauty shops is that they don’t know how to fade well. Rio Vista Barber was right in that sweet spot and I’m happy I went! I called in to see if I had to make an appointment and Ed had told me I can but they also take walk-ins. This was nice as some of the places I considered were always booked and my mop needed a chop! Upon arriving I was greeted very quickly and I was sitting in a chair for my cut in no time! Ed listened carefully and also asked me some questions to clarify. He was very personable. We talked about our families and even politics(which I try to avoid with newly met people). I really love that old school barber mentality. This is definitely a place where a guy can feel pampered, in a guy kind of way. After some good conversation and watching some golf Ed turned me around and showed me my new doo. It was perfect! He took a lot of time on my fade which I really like. And, the top was trimmed but not to short that I couldn’t comb it over. I’m now ready to attend my trade show next week! Ed’s professional manner, personable conversations, and expert technique has just earned Rio Vista Barbers a client for the long run. Thanks so much!

4.5 out of 5. Ed was my barber for this visit. He was cordial, professional and actually took the time to LISTEN on what kind of hair cut I wanted. I requested a skin low fade. And a skin low fade he did. He finished my cut with a straight razor in the back and on the sides-this includes a clean hot towel to finish. All this for less than $ 20 bucks(tip not included). It’s spring gentlemen: get your barbered haircut.

What ever happened to no-nonsense barber shops? Thanks to a little Unilocal from my friends, I found this spot for a quick haircut on my way to work. Simple old-school spot. Nothing fancy. Just a few old guys giving straight up hair cuts for a reasonable price. What I liked the most is that they still break out a little hot shaving cream and the straight razor to clean up the neck and edges. Then a little hot towel, and off you go! Gotta love preservation of the art!
